About the role

You will be field based (Essex) reporting to the Slough Office as part of our on-site presence, ensuring that all of our products are maintained in line with the service schedule, and ensuring that any breakdowns are dealt with in a timely and efficient manner.

Therefore, you will be proficient in fault finding and diagnostics, you will be at the top of your game and will understand the importance of ensuring all products are working to the top of their ability. As well as being an adept engineer with relevant qualifications, you will be good at maintaining a clean and organised work environment and be efficient at the associated paperwork. In addition, you will be a good communicator with clients, the team on-site and the back office.

Duties and responsibilities:

  • Attend machine breakdowns at customer sites and effect repairs to ensure minimum machine down time.
  • Carry out scheduled servicing of machines at customer sites.
  • Troubleshoot and fault find any defects on machines and carry out repairs as necessary.
  • To ensure that work is carried out to the highest standard and on time.
  • Ensure that service reports, time sheets etc are completed correctly and submitted on time.
  • To carry out any other general duties within the capability of the post holder, that may be requested from time to time by management.

Experience and Qualifications:

  • NVQ Lv3 in Plant and Machinery or equivalent.
  • Knowledge of auto-electrics; engines; after-treatment devices; transmissions and hydraulic systems.
  • Ability to diagnose faults on heavy construction equipment and carry out repairs.
  • Carry out routine maintenance on heavy construction machinery.
  • Able to work under pressure and on own initiative without supervision.
  • Self-motivated and able to work to very high standards.
  • Good literacy and IT competency.
